My Husband and I always plan time at the Renaissance Island private cove. You can opt for a couples massage or just spend the afternoon over there. We usually stay at the hotel, but I believe that anyone can pay to use this service. I could be wrong, but I did stay at the Mariott Ocean Club 3yrs ago instead of the Ren. & we still were able to use the cove. Typically we spend @300-400 for the full day with massage. But it is worth every penny to be out there by ourselves! We usually spend the late afternoon over there with a massage around 4pm. They do offer a morning package as well. They serve a fruit plate w/ a bottle of champagne. Or you can choose lunch & 2 drinks of your choice. I also think that if you get any package, you are able to stay on the island for the remainder of the day. You can download a spa menu, page 3 has all the options.
